TICKET-2277 (for Thursday's eng sync): The Pallasgate barcode scanner integration failed its signature check during the 14:00 deploy. The bundle was signed with last quarter's retired key, so the gateway correctly rejected it. Root cause: stale CI secret. Rotation is complete and the pipeline now references the active key, shown below for verification.

release key, fahaf-bajof: bky3_Xam

In this step you move the scanner integration from the legacy Verlane driver to the new `scanbridge` service. Unplug nothing yet — scanbridge runs alongside the old driver until cutover. Install the service, register each lane's scanner by its device slot, and verify test scans appear in the diagnostics panel. Symbologies beyond standard retail barcodes must be enabled explicitly; they're off by default. Before registering devices, write the service configuration file with the following values.

config for kafof-bawef:
holath:
  log_level: debug
  metrics_host: metrics.holath.qorvelsys.internal
  pin: 2191
  pool_size: 32

Onboarding: Spoolhawk service. Spoolhawk handles print-job queuing for all Verrantine offices. Releases cut from the stable branch only; the release manager signs the manifest before rollout. Canary runs in the Delmbrook cluster for 30 minutes, then full fleet. Rollback is one command; see the ops card. If the signing vault is sealed after a failed deploy, you must unseal it before the next cut. Use the recovery passphrase below to unseal the release vault.

vault phrase of bahap-kadup = gorvan-frador-aldax-gilax-novmir-fenion-aldius-jorius-pelius

Subject: Sale of the Ambervale Instruments Unit

Team,

Following board approval, we have signed heads of terms to divest the Ambervale Instruments unit to Corrin Holdings. Finance should begin carve-out work immediately: separate ledgers by month end, prepare a twelve-month pro forma excluding the unit, and quantify stranded overhead costs. Completion is targeted for the first quarter, subject to due diligence. Please treat all workings as strictly confidential. The strategic rationale is summarised in the note appended directly below.

board note of bawep-tajef: Queniusek Systems plans to raise the Quenvan list price by 53.1 percent in March. The pricing group signed off on a budget of $176.4 million for Project Drueth. The renewal with Casionix Partners closes at $142.5 million a year, 8.3 percent below the last contract. Project Fraax slips by six weeks because of the tooling delay.